Output eb5e2ce6872e6d5bd2ec3fcd5e4895740d23714109f07fa0ac4bd2f775dada35:8

value
666851
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fcb7758da8a27b31494e559054881560027558fd OP_EQUAL
address
3QjFyrSRzwKw1Qt11MmygQGHPHaWD8BLMt
transaction
eb5e2ce6872e6d5bd2ec3fcd5e4895740d23714109f07fa0ac4bd2f775dada35
confirmations
65263
spent
true